The model was lucrative to the policy makers now and the concept of exchange rate overshooting in response to monetary shock was introduced on grounds of rationality.... (Obstfeld and Rogoff, 1984) Due to the inverse relationship between bond price and market rate of interest, the market rate of interest will fall.... This fall in market rate of interest will be followed by a huge capital outflow.... This phenomenon will lead to a contraction in money supply and it will continue till the market rate of interest rises to its initial level, that is, till the initial expansionary monetary policy gets fully crowded out....

Friedel takes pains to distinguish his concept of improvement from the notion of progress that economic historians such as Joel Mokyr and David Landes take as central to their accounts of essentially the same material.... While Friedel acknowledges economic incentives and offers numerous insights into the ways they influenced technical practitioners, he considers the drive for improvement a broader and deeper phenomenon that operates through mechanisms other than just the market....
